  3. PwnQuest Augur

    tldr version, they don't have the dev time or resources to enforce no-boxing rules. Truebox is a nice compromise, preventing the mass multiboxing that we saw on Ragefire/Lockjaw, but allowing some 2+ boxing when you have multiple computers. Multiboxing is not rampant on TLPs these days, contrary to what some on these forums would have you believe.
  4. Jogath Journeyman

    There is no technical way to prevent boxing. If you prevent by external IP, you prevent families and LAN parties (and potentially entire colleges). If you do what they do now with Truebox, you enforce one per machine.
